GSA Environmental Services Schedule

GSAThe General Services Administration (GSA) has established a Federal Supply Schedule for Environmental Services. The Schedule is a list of qualified contractors that have been evaluated for capabilities and competitive pricing, and have been awarded a contract by GSA to perform environmental services for Federal agencies. Any Federal agency can access approved contractors through the GSA Schedule.

This streamlined procurement vehicle has wide technical scope - and the job of pre-approving contractors, evaluating capabilities, and assuring that competition requirements are met has already been done by GSA! Consequently, the administrative burden for procuring services under a GSA Schedule - and the timeline - is greatly reduced.

Who Can Use the GSA Schedule...

The GSA Schedule is available to all Federal agencies of the Executive, Legislative, and Judicial branches. Numerous Federally-supported, intergovernmental, and international organizations are also eligible, as are Government contractors authorized in writing by a Federal agency pursuant to CFR 51.1.
